How they compare

Czechia currently reports 56 t against 46 t in Libya, a difference of 10 t.

That makes Czechia's figure about 1.2 times Libya's.

The two have swapped places 6 times across 18 shared years of data; in 1998 it was Libya ahead.

Czechia ranks 102nd and Libya ranks 105th of 128 countries.

Across the 3 decades both report, Czechia averaged higher in 2 and Libya in 1.

The database contains data on the bilateral trade flows in roundwood, primary wood and paper products for all countries and territories in the world. The main types of primary forest products included in are: roundwood, sawnwood, wood-based panels, pulp, and paper and paperboard. These products are detailed further. The definitions are available.
